Infosys is seeking a Quality Engineering Lead/Technical Test Lead - Mainframe, Python skillsets

As a QA Test Lead, you will act as a validation and quality assurance expert and review the functionality of existing systems. You will conduct requirement analysis, define test strategy & design and lead execution to guarantee superior outcomes. You will also be required to design an optimal test environment to simulate real-time scenarios. You will have the opportunity to collaborate with some of the best talent in the industry to create innovative high quality and defect-free solutions to meet our clients' business needs. You will be part of a learning culture, where teamwork and collaboration are encouraged, excellence is rewarded, and diversity is respected and valued.

Basic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ree or foreign equivalent required from an accredited institution. Will also consider three years of progressive experience in the specialty in lieu of every year of education.
  • Candidates must be located within commuting distance of Richardson, TX or must be willing to relocate to the area. This position may require travel within the US.
  • Candidates authorized to work for any employer in the United States without employer-based visa sponsorship are welcome to apply. Infosys is unable to provide immigration sponsorship for this role at this time
  • 4+ years of experience in software QA, with at least 2 years in a lead role.
  • Mainframe & Python experience is mandatory.
Preferred Qualifications
  • Experience with CI/CD tools (e.g., Jenkins, GitLab CI).
  • Exposure to cloud-native telecom solutions
  • Knowledge of scripting languages (e.g., Python) for test automation.
  • 4 years of experience in Automation and testing Skills in creating Test Strategy, Test scenarios and Test cases with hands on technical knowledge.
  • Strong domain knowledge in telecom systems.
  • Proficiency in test management and defect tracking tools.
  • Hands-on experience with automation tools (e.g., Selenium).
  • Experience in programming/scripting languages (e.g., Unix, Java, Python, Mainframe).
  • Familiarity with Agile/Scrum methodologies.
  • Excellent leadership, communication, and stakeholder management skills.
  • Experience in working in offshore and onsite model.
  • Lead and mentor a team of QA analysts and engineers across telecom projects.
  • Define and implement QA strategies, test plans, and test cases tailored to telecom systems.
  • Coordinate with cross-functional teams including development, product management, and operations to ensure quality objectives are met.
  • Oversee execution of functional, regression, integration, and system testing.
  • Manage defect tracking and resolution using tools like JIRA.
  • Drive automation initiatives and maintain test automation frameworks.
  • Ensure compliance with telecom standards and regulatory requirements.
  • Define and execute test strategies for functional, UI/UX, compatibility, functional testing.
  • Provide regular QA status reports, metrics, and risk assessments to stakeholders.
  • Participate in Agile/Scrum ceremonies and contribute to continuous improvement.
